ospf LSP and LSA header format

Home » Blog » Routing » ospf » ospf teoria » ospf LSP and LSA header format

ospf LSP and LSA header format

04.01 2020 | by massimiliano

OSPF header format       Link State Request: sono impiegati da un router per richiedere ad una’altro nodo della […]


https://www.ingegnerianetworking.com/wp-content/uploads/2020/01/ospf-header-452.png

OSPF header format

 

ospf header

 

 

Link State Request: sono impiegati da un router per richiedere ad una’altro nodo della rete l’invio di uno o più LSA; gli LSA richiesti sono identificati dal loro tipo, identificatore e creatore

 

Link State Update: indica un insieme di LSA che il router mittente deve inviare agli altri nodi della rete su un collegamento.

 

Si deve tener presente che questi LSA non sono necessariamente generati dal router mittente del pacchetto ma possono essere stati generati da altri router, quando si rende necessario come ad esempio per effetto di un cambiamento della topologia della rete oppure quando sia stata ricevuta una richiesta di invio di LSA e quando non venga ricevuta la conferma di un precedente invio.

 

Link State Acknowledgement: questi indicano l’avvenuta ricezione di un insieme di LSA precedentemente inviati all’interno di un pacchetto link state update

 

 

OSPF prevede cinque tipi di LSA utilizzati per informare della topologia di rete in contesti differenti:

 vedi anche: https://www.massimilianosbaraglia.it/routing/ospf/ospf-teoria/ospf-lsa-link-state-advertisement

 

router LSA

network LSA

summary LSA

AS boundary router summary LSA

AS external LSA

 

 

Formato LSA:

 

ospf lsa header

 

 

 

Link State Type: indica il tipo di LSA sopra indicato

 

Link State Age: ogni LSA è soggetto ad invecchiamento che viene incrementato sia quando un LSA è propagato in rete, sia quando questo è conservato all’interno della base dati di un router

raggiunta un età massima l’LSA viene rimosso ed il router genera periodicamente nuove copie in modo che, sino a quando le informazioni sono valide, non vengano scartate per invecchiamento.

la funzionalità di invecchiamento, comunque, è utile soprattutto per forzare l’eliminazione di LSA per dati non più valide (ad esempio quando un router avverte che una destinazione non è più raggiungibile ed invia una nuova copia LSA con il valore massimo di age nel relativo field); di conseguenza tutti i router che ricevono questa nuova copia, la sostituiscono con quella che hanno nella loro base dati eliminandola perchè ha raggiunto la massima età ammessa.

 

Link State ID: identifica il nodo di rete di cui l’LSA porta le informazioni; in altre parole identifica l’LSA stesso

 

Advertising Router: contiene l’identificatore del router che ha generato l’LSA; questo non coincide necessariamente con il router che ha inviato il pacchetto contenente l’LSA (identificato questo dal router-id)

 

Link State Sequence Number: il router numera le copie successive dello stesso LSA mediante una sequenza; questo permette agli altri router appartenenti allo stesso processo di propagazione degli LSA di distinguere copie differenti dello stesso LSA ed applicare le regole del selective-flooding.

 

 

Vedi anche: https://www.massimilianosbaraglia.it/routing/ospf/ospf-teoria/ospf-lsa-permesse-all-interno-delle-rispettive-aree-type

 

 

OSPF Hello header:

 

 ospf hello header

 

 

 

 

 OSPF DataBase Descriptior header:

 

 ospf db descriptor header

 

Torna in alto